    Which AI Writing Assistant is Right for You?

    Grammarly and ProWritingAid both help you write better, but they approach the task differently. Grammarly prioritizes simplicity; ProWritingAid offers depth. Here's how to choose.

    Grammarly: The Accessible Choice

    Grammarly has become synonymous with writing assistance. It works everywhere and requires zero learning curve.

    Strengths:

  1. Works everywhere (browser, desktop, mobile)
  2. Extremely easy to use
  3. GrammarlyGO AI assistant
  4. Tone detection
  5. Clean, unintimidating interface
  6. Weaknesses:

  7. Less detailed analysis
  8. Can be too prescriptive
  9. Higher price for premium
  10. AI features locked to higher tiers
  11. **Best for:** Business professionals, students, and anyone wanting frictionless writing help.

  17. ProWritingAid: The Writer's Workshop

    ProWritingAid is built for serious writers who want to understand and improve their craft, not just fix errors.

    Strengths:

  18. Deep writing analysis (20+ reports)
  19. Excellent for creative writing
  20. Style guides and goals
  21. Integration with Scrivener
  22. More affordable than Grammarly
  23. Weaknesses:

  24. More complex interface
  25. Can be overwhelming
  26. Fewer integrations
  27. Suggestions sometimes over-detailed
  28. **Best for:** Fiction writers, bloggers, and anyone who wants to deeply improve their writing skills.

    ProWritingAid Features

  29. 20+ writing reports
  30. Style analysis
  31. Pacing and readability checks
  32. Dialogue and cliché detection
  33. Thesaurus and word explorer
  34. AI writing assistant

    Head-to-Head Tests

    Test 1: Quick Email Check

    **Task:** Fix errors in a business email

  36. **Grammarly:** Instant, clean suggestions, one-click fixes
  37. **ProWritingAid:** Good catches but more cluttered interface
  38. **Winner:** Grammarly

    Test 2: Long-Form Article

    **Task:** Edit a 2,000-word blog post for readability

  39. **Grammarly:** Basic suggestions, improves clarity
  40. **ProWritingAid:** Deep analysis, specific actionable feedback
  41. **Winner:** ProWritingAid

    Test 3: Fiction Writing

    **Task:** Edit a creative short story

  42. **Grammarly:** Fixes grammar but doesn't understand creative voice
  43. **ProWritingAid:** Respects creative choices, focuses on pacing and dialogue
  44. **Winner:** ProWritingAid

    Test 4: Real-Time Writing

    **Task:** Compose a document with assistance as you type

  45. **Grammarly:** Seamless, suggestions appear instantly
  46. **ProWritingAid:** Good but slightly less responsive
  47. **Winner:** Grammarly

    Pricing Comparison

    Grammarly:

  48. Free: Basic grammar and spelling
  49. Premium: $12/month (annual) or $30/month
  50. Business: $15/user/month
  51. ProWritingAid:

  52. Free: Basic checks, 500 words
  53. Premium: $10/month (annual)
  54. Premium+: $12/month (with plagiarism)
  55. Lifetime: $399 one-time
  56. **For long-term value:** ProWritingAid's lifetime option is unbeatable.

    When to Use Each

    Choose Grammarly when:

  57. You want zero friction
  58. Business writing is your focus
  59. You need mobile and browser support
  60. Quick fixes matter more than deep analysis
  61. You want AI writing assistance (GrammarlyGO)
  62. Choose ProWritingAid when:

  63. You're a serious writer
  64. You want to improve your craft
  65. Fiction or long-form content is your focus
  66. Budget is a concern
  67. You use Scrivener
  68. Can You Use Both?

    Yes, some writers use:

  69. **Grammarly** for everyday emails and quick checks
  70. **ProWritingAid** for serious writing projects
  71. The Verdict

    **For convenience:** Grammarly

    **For depth:** ProWritingAid

    **For value:** ProWritingAid (especially lifetime)

    **Our recommendation:** Business professionals should choose Grammarly for its frictionless experience. Serious writers—especially fiction authors—will get more value from ProWritingAid's detailed analysis.
